Originally Posted by JumboJack Yes like a POD without the effects.....The main thing that makes a BDDI (or any DI for that matter) cool is that if you have good PA support (which most decent sized churches have) you dont need an amp and cab....THAT is easy peasy...  | Oh very nice very nice. I bring my amp/cab to morning service because it's literally RIGHT across the street and it's easy to roll over there. Then I go from my amp to the system. The mix between the monitors and the bassyness of my cab is nice.
But night service is out on the outskirts of town and I don't like hauling my stuff out, so I plug directly into the system. So one of these would be nice to give the sound some character. |
